Moderate polling in progress in Assam

Moderate polling is reported in altogether eleven Lok Sabha constituencies in Assam after voting began at 7 in the morning. Barring a few stray incidents, polling is by and large peaceful. The turn out is said to be low during the early hours in most of these constituencies due to drizzle from early in the morning. Prime Minister Dr Manmohan Singh is casting his vote at the Dispur HS School. Assam Chief Minister Tarun Gogoi has also cast his vote in Jorhat. There are reports of technical snags in some parts of the state.
